KOZA MOSTRA, one of the most internationally acclaimed and nationally influential Greek bands of the past decade that has captivated audiences with its unique fusion of traditional Greek music with genres such as hard rock, ska & punk. This innovative blend has inspired a new generation of artists to challenge genre boundaries while exploring their cultural heritage.
Formed in 2012 by Ilias Kozas, Koza Mostra quickly rose to prominence, earning widespread acclaim with their international debut at Eurovision 2013 in Sweden, where they performed the energetic and unforgettable song "Alcohol is Free". The song remains a fan favourite, amassing over 12 million views across various YouTube uploads.
Their debut album, Keep Up The Rhythm. The album was a resounding success, selling over 150,000 physical copies and 300,000 digital downloads to date.
In 2015, following a personal request of Mikis Theodorakis, they made a cover of one of his politically most famous songs “Leventis”, thus becoming the first of the new generation artists who were allowed to “ touch” his legacy.
Their second album, Corrida, was released in late 2017. Its bold, genre-defying sound solidified Koza Mostra’s reputation as a truly unique band.
On their third album “Malaka” (December 2024) Koza Mostra worked together with a great team including 2 Grammy Nominated Svante Forsbäck (Rammstein, Eskimo Callboy, Apocalyptica and many more) who did the mastering of the album. Not to mention the collaboration with Gogol Bordello’s Pedrito who joined forces with KM on “Requiem”, a song about solidarity.
Until now, they were relentlessly touring in Europe while sharing the stage with artists such as Iron Maiden, Judas Priest, Gogol Bordello, Goran Bregovic, Madness, and many more.
Renowned for their high-energy performances, KOZA MOSTRA has become a staple at festivals, events, and club shows across Europe. The band delivers a unique artistic experience that unites audiences in celebration.
